    First off and foremost, it looks like the name cleanup has gone off pretty smoothly - Over 780,000 names were removed from the servers yesterday, giving people plenty of new nicks they can pick and choose from. It was actually really amusing watching some of the new nicknames rolling in on n00b island yesterday - Always good to see folks out and about regardless.

    Work on the Daily Missions is slowly starting to come to a close, and we're hoping we can have them out for the live servers Very Soon™. There's a lot of really interesting, fun, cool content coming in with the daily missions that I think you guys are going to enjoy - We've really tried to think outside the box with some of the missions, and hopefully you'll be happy with the end results. One of the cool things about the daily missions system, too, is that it's a very modular design, meaning we'll be able to easily add in new missions for the system in the future, keeping variety up and hopefully ensuring that nothing gets too stale. Doing these missions has also given us a good chance to go in and tweak/fix a bunch of various little things that annoyed the crap outta us (like some floating rocks, weirdly-dressed NPCs, ect. ect.) so there's been much, much more done than just the actual mission implementation itself. In a way it's given us a chance to do a little bit of tweak 'n polish to oldskool Rubi-Ka, which is always nice.

    Meanwhile, the Collector instance has received some additional fun over the last few weeks, with Means putting in some hard work on the encounters leading up to the main boss area. The Collector instance is designed from the ground up to be very, very different from all other content in the game, and I really think it's coming together. The initial feedback we've gotten from people on Testlive has been exceedingly positive, and I'm seriously looking forward to watching people mess around in there. Let's just say we've got a few nifty tricks up our sleeves with this one. Was actually hoping I could show some more screenshots from there today, but Means forgot and left the playfield open on his computer yesterday, which unfortunately means no one else can get into it at the moment. Hooray for the AO tools. ><

    Engine work continues to come along quite nicely - Unfortunately I don't have anything to show there *either* (holy crap worst fw(o)m evar), but I can say that it's looking pretty good over at Parsed's desk at the moment. We're also going to be shipping out Flaptoot in the next few weeks and sending him over to our Beijing office where he'll be overseeing and helping with the new head model production - Macrosun tried to convince the top brass that we should all be sent over with him, but no dice. . We got the new Atrox head you guys saw a few weeks back into the new engine earlier this week and... holy crap. It's so cool seeing stuff like this come together, particularly as an old AO fanboy myself - Watching the new shinies come together and breathe new life into the old familiarity of AO is really something spectacular.
